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To deter crime from developing though personal information is protected by a method wherein the fingerprint of a person, who signs slips, is taken without introducing a system on a large scale in order to identify the person in question by utilizing the slip. <P>SOLUTION: In the sales slip 10 of a credit card, in addition to general items, a signature column 12 by a card user and a fingerprint recording part 14, in which the fingerprint of the card user is taken, are provided. The fingerprint recording part 14 consists of a recording film 16 for taking a fingerprint from a finger 36 pressed down, a frame-like sheet 18 for positioning a fingerprint recording site and a protective sheet 20 for protecting a recorded fingerprint under the condition that the rear surface of the recording film 16 is pasted to the front surface of the sales slip 10 by a proper means. The sales slip 10, by which the fingerprint of the card user is utilized for checking up the fingerprint of a nominee himself or herself only when unfair utilization or the like by a person except the nominee is suspected.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2007,JPO&INPIT

最初に、図1及び図2を参照しながら本発明の実施例1を説明する。図1(A)は、本実施例1の全体を示す平面図,図1(B)は指紋採取部を拡大して示す斜視図,図1(C)は指紋を採取する様子を示す図である。図2は、採取フィルムの層構造の一例を示す断面図である。本実施例は、商品の購入時などにクレジットカード決済を利用したときにカード利用者が署名するクレジットカード売上票に本発明を適用したものである。   First, Embodiment 1 of the present invention will be described with reference to FIGS. FIG. 1A is a plan view showing the whole of the first embodiment, FIG. 1B is an enlarged perspective view of a fingerprint collecting unit, and FIG. 1C is a diagram showing how a fingerprint is collected. is there. FIG. 2 is a cross-sectional view showing an example of the layer structure of the collected film. In this embodiment, the present invention is applied to a credit card sales slip signed by a card user when credit card settlement is used at the time of purchase of goods or the like.

図1(A)に示すように、クレジットカード売上票(以下「売上票」)10は、一般的な売上票と同様に、加盟店,伝票番号,利用日,会員番号,有効期限,処理番号,商品区分,金額,分割回数などの所定の項目のほか、カード利用者による署名欄12を備えている。また、本実施例の売上票10では、前記署名欄12の下側に、カード利用者,すなわち署名者の指紋を採取するための指紋採取部14が設けられている。なお、図示の例では、署名欄12の下側に指紋採取部14を設けているが、その位置は必要に応じて適宜変更してよい。   As shown in FIG. 1 (A), the credit card sales slip (hereinafter referred to as “sales slip”) 10 is a member store, slip number, date of use, membership number, expiration date, and processing number in the same manner as a general sales slip. In addition to predetermined items such as product category, amount of money, number of divisions, etc., a card user signature column 12 is provided. Further, in the sales slip 10 of this embodiment, a fingerprint collecting unit 14 for collecting the fingerprint of the card user, that is, the signer, is provided below the signature column 12. In the example shown in the figure, the fingerprint collecting unit 14 is provided below the signature field 12, but the position thereof may be changed as necessary.

前記指紋採取部14は、図1(B)及び(C)に示すように、押下された指36から指紋を採取する採取フィルム16,該採取フィルム16上の指紋採取部位を位置決めするための枠状シート18,採取された指紋に他者の指紋や汚れなどが付着しないように、前記採取フィルム16の表面を覆う保護シート20により構成されている。前記枠状シート18は、裏面に設けられた接着剤などによって採取フィルム16の表面に貼り合わせられている。また、前記保護シート20は、前記採取フィルム16と一辺側が綴じられており、指紋を採取するときには捲ることができるようになっている。更に、前記枠状シート18の表面には、接着剤層18Aが設けられており、前記保護シート20の剥離・粘着が可能となっている。このような指紋採取部14は、前記採取フィルム16の裏面全体または一部が、接着剤などの適宜手段で、売上票10の表面に貼り付けられている。   As shown in FIGS. 1 (B) and 1 (C), the fingerprint collecting unit 14 has a collection film 16 for collecting a fingerprint from a pressed finger 36 and a frame for positioning a fingerprint collection portion on the collection film 16. The sheet 18 is composed of a protective sheet 20 that covers the surface of the collected film 16 so that fingerprints and dirt of others are not attached to the collected fingerprint. The frame-like sheet 18 is bonded to the surface of the collection film 16 with an adhesive or the like provided on the back surface. Further, the protective sheet 20 is bound on one side with the collection film 16 so that it can be rolled when collecting fingerprints. Further, an adhesive layer 18A is provided on the surface of the frame-shaped sheet 18, and the protective sheet 20 can be peeled and adhered. In such a fingerprint collecting unit 14, the entire back surface or a part of the collecting film 16 is attached to the surface of the sales slip 10 by an appropriate means such as an adhesive.

前記採取フィルム16としては、指紋を採取することができるものであれば、どのような構成のものであってもよいが、図2(A)に示すように、ポリエチレン層22の上に乳剤層24やゼラチン層を設けた構造のものを利用すると、採取した指紋が、一定期間(例えば、数ヶ月)経過した後に薄れたり消えたりするため、必要以上に個人の生体情報が残ることがなく、個人情報漏洩のおそれを低減することができる。なお、通常、クレジットカードの請求は、カード利用日から所定の期間内にカード名義人に対して行われるため、請求の明細を見て心当たりのない利用が記載されている場合に、カード会社に届け出ることができる程度の期間指紋を保存しておくことができれば十分であり、必ずしも半永久的ないし長期的な保存は必要ではない。   The collection film 16 may have any configuration as long as it can collect fingerprints, but as shown in FIG. 2A, an emulsion layer is formed on the polyethylene layer 22. 24 or using a structure with a gelatin layer, the collected fingerprint fades or disappears after a certain period (for example, several months), so that personal biometric information does not remain more than necessary, The risk of leakage of personal information can be reduced. Usually, credit card billing is made to the card holder within a predetermined period from the card usage date, so if you see unfamiliar use by looking at the billing details, It is sufficient that the fingerprint can be stored for a period that can be reported, and it is not always necessary to store it semipermanently or for a long time.

あるいは、図2(B)に示す他の採取フィルム26のように、所定の処理ないし加工を行った印画紙を用いることにより、指紋を半永久的に保存できるような構成としてもよい。前記指紋採取フィルム26は、ポリエチレン層28,原紙30,ポリエチレン層32,ゼラチン層34を順に重ねた構成となっており、前記ゼラチン層34を、ミョウバンを添加した定着液で硬膜処理したものに指紋を写し取ることにより、指紋を長期間保存することができる。このような長期保存型の採取フィルム26は、カードの利用額が一定額以上の場合など、必要に応じて利用するようにしてよい。なお、前記採取フィルム16,26のいずれも、フィルムを黒色ないし暗色にすると、指紋が確認しやすくなるので都合がよい。   Alternatively, a configuration may be adopted in which fingerprints can be stored semipermanently by using photographic paper that has been subjected to predetermined processing or processing, as in another sample film 26 shown in FIG. The fingerprint collecting film 26 has a structure in which a polyethylene layer 28, a base paper 30, a polyethylene layer 32, and a gelatin layer 34 are sequentially stacked, and the gelatin layer 34 is hardened with a fixing solution to which alum is added. By copying the fingerprint, the fingerprint can be stored for a long time. Such a long-term storage-type collection film 26 may be used as necessary, such as when the card usage amount is a certain amount or more. In addition, it is convenient for both the collecting films 16 and 26 to make it easier to confirm the fingerprint if the film is black or dark.

次に、本実施例の売上票10を利用した本人確認方法について説明する。カード利用者は、決済時にレジで発行される売上票10の署名欄12に署名をし、図1(C)に示すように、指紋採取部14の保護シート20を捲り、採取フィルム16に指36を押し当てる。指紋をうつしたら、他者の指紋や汚れなどが付着しないように、保護シート20で指紋採取フィルム16を覆う。指紋が採取された売上票10は、カードが利用された店舗などで通常通り保管される。一方、利用されたカードの名義人が、カード会社から心当たりのない請求を受けた場合には、前記売上票10が参照される。このとき、署名された名前,すなわち、カード名義人本人の指紋と、売上票10に採取された指紋を照合することにより、名義人本人が利用したか否かの確認を行うことができる。このため、盗用やなりすましなどの不正利用の抑制にも効果がある。更に、必要に応じて採取された指紋を警察や専門機関などに提出することにより、不正利用の証拠として活用したり、不正利用者の特定に役立てたりすることも可能である。   Next, an identity verification method using the sales slip 10 of the present embodiment will be described. The card user signs the signature column 12 of the sales slip 10 issued at the cash register at the time of settlement, rolls the protective sheet 20 of the fingerprint collecting unit 14 as shown in FIG. Press 36. When the fingerprint is transferred, the fingerprint collecting film 16 is covered with a protective sheet 20 so that fingerprints and dirt of other people do not adhere. The sales slip 10 from which the fingerprint is collected is stored as usual in a store where the card is used. On the other hand, when the holder of the card used receives an unexpected charge from the card company, the sales slip 10 is referred to. At this time, it is possible to confirm whether or not the name has been used by checking the signed name, that is, the fingerprint of the card holder and the fingerprint collected in the sales slip 10. For this reason, it is also effective in suppressing unauthorized use such as plagiarism and impersonation. Furthermore, by submitting fingerprints collected as necessary to the police or specialized agencies, it is possible to use them as evidence of unauthorized use or to identify unauthorized users.

次に、図3を参照しながら、本発明の実施例2を説明する。上述した実施例1では、署名と指紋採取により本人確認を行うこととしたが、本実施例は、他の本人確認手段を併用した例である。まず、図3(A)に示す出金票50は、銀行の窓口で預金を引き出すために記入するものであって、署名欄52と指紋採取部54のほか、捺印欄56が設けられている。なお、前記指紋採取部54は、上述した実施例1の指紋採取部14と同様の構成である。また、図3(B)に示す出金票60は、署名欄62,指紋採取部64,捺印欄66のほか、顔写真68の添付欄が設けられている。前記顔写真68は、必ずしも添付する必要はなく、現金の引き出し額が一定額以上(例えば、100万円以上など)である場合にのみ、デジタルカメラなどで撮影して顔写真を添付するようにしてもよい。なお、図3(B)に示す例では、出金票60自体は通常の紙を使用したものであるが、出金票60全体を印画紙とし、顔写真68を撮影して現像したものに、前記指紋採取部64を設けて、出金票60に直接指36を押下するようにしてもよい。このようにすると、出金票60自体を長期保存する場合に好適である。本実施例の基本的作用・効果は、前記実施例1と同様であるが、本実施例のように、必要に応じて、指紋以外の本人確認手段を併用することにより、セキュリティレベルの向上を図ることができる。   Next, Embodiment 2 of the present invention will be described with reference to FIG. In the first embodiment described above, identity verification is performed by collecting a signature and a fingerprint, but this embodiment is an example in which other identity verification means are used in combination. First, a withdrawal slip 50 shown in FIG. 3 (A) is entered to withdraw a deposit at a bank counter, and includes a signature column 52 and a fingerprint collecting unit 54 as well as a stamping column 56. . The fingerprint collecting unit 54 has the same configuration as the fingerprint collecting unit 14 of the first embodiment described above. In addition, the withdrawal slip 60 shown in FIG. 3B is provided with an attachment field for a face photograph 68 in addition to a signature field 62, a fingerprint collecting unit 64, and a seal field 66. The face picture 68 does not necessarily have to be attached. Only when the amount of cash withdrawal is a certain amount (for example, 1 million yen or more), the face picture 68 is taken with a digital camera or the like to attach the face picture. May be. In the example shown in FIG. 3 (B), the withdrawal slip 60 itself uses ordinary paper. However, the entire withdrawal slip 60 is photographic paper, and a face photograph 68 is taken and developed. The fingerprint collecting unit 64 may be provided so that the finger 36 is pressed directly on the withdrawal slip 60. This is suitable when the withdrawal slip 60 itself is stored for a long time. The basic functions and effects of this embodiment are the same as those of the first embodiment. However, as in this embodiment, the security level can be improved by using identity verification means other than fingerprints as necessary. Can be planned.
